AC power sources provide alternating power and typically have adjustable output values for the testing of component response at various voltages, current and frequency levels.
Camera lenses and video lenses attach to video cameras for use in machine vision, quality monitoring, security, and remote monitoring for industrial and commercial operations. This search form does not cover consumer video camera lenses. 
Charge coupled device (CCD) cameras contain light-sensitive silicon chips that detect electrons excited by incoming light. They also contain micro circuitry that transfers a detected signal along a row of discrete picture elements or pixels, scanning the image very rapidly. CCD cameras use two-dimensional CCD arrays with many thousand of pixels.
Color filters include a wide range of filter types that are distinguished by their specific color spectrums and wavelengths, as well as their Schott glass compositions.
Current sources provide reliable current for electrical component testing and for powering specialized components.
DC power supplies accept an input power and output the desired form of DC power. Common types of DC power supplies include linear power supplies, switching power supplies, DC-DC converters, and silicon controlled rectifier (SCR) type power supplies.
DC-DC converters accept DC input and provide regulated and/or isolated DC output in various applications including computer flash memory, telecommunications equipment, and process control systems.
Diode lasers use light-emitting diodes to produce stimulated emissions in the form of coherent light output. They are also known as laser diodes.
Fiber optic light guides are bundles of optical fibers used for the controlled deliver of light. They tend to be more rigid, and transmit well in both the visible and near-infrared (near-IR) regions of the electromagnetic spectrum.  Fiber optic light guides are sometimes called fiber optic light pipes (fiber optic lightpipes). 
Illuminators are used to provide adequate contrast for imaging. Illuminators include backlights, LED illuminators, and fiber optic illuminators.
Lasers are devices that produce intense beams of monochromatic, coherent radiation. The word "laser" is an acronym for Light Amplification by Stimulated Emission of Radiation.
Light guides conduct the flow of light from a light source to a point of use in areas that are too small or too hazardous to permit the installation of a light bulb. There are two basic types of light guides: liquid and fiber optic.  Light guides are sometimes called light pipes (lightpipes).
Lighting controls include monitors, communication systems, and other devices for controlling facility lighting systems.
Linear polarizers transmit light waves along one axis and absorb them along the other. The transmitting and absorbing axes of linear polarization are oriented at 90 degrees to each other.
Long pass filters transmit a wide spectral band of long wavelength radiation while blocking short wavelength radiation. Short pass filters transmit a wide spectral band of short wavelength radiation and block long wave radiation.
Low light cameras are designed for low light applications. They contain sensors that are highly sensitive to light and reduce images to a series of lines.
Neutral density filters are designed to reduce transmission evenly across a portion of the spectrum. They are slightly sensitive to angles but they are much more forgiving than interference filters.
Optical bandpass filters are designed to transmit a specific waveband.  They are composed of many thin layers of dielectric materials, which have differing refractive indices to produce constructive and destructive interference in the transmitted light.
Optical diffusers scatter incident light, thereby reducing the sensitivity of a detection system to slight positional or angle changes in an incoming beam.
Optical mounts are specialized holders designed for use with a variety of optical assemblies.
Optical polarizers are optical devices that can transform unpolarized or natural light into polarized light, usually by the selective transmission of polarized rays.
Power cables are solid or stranded conductors surrounded by insulation, shielding, and a protective jacket.  These cables are designed for high voltages (>600 V).
Power supplies are devices that produce AC or DC power.  This grouping includes current sources, DC power supplies, AC-DC adapters, DC-DC converters, AC power sources, and DC-AC inverters.
Video cameras take continuous pictures and generate signals for display or recording. They capture images by breaking them down into a series of lines. This search form does not include consumer devices such as camcorders.
